My ‘79 doesn’t use rivets on the outside. It a...

My ‘79 doesn’t use rivets on the outside. It a sandwich system where the inside trim pulls the outside tight against the butyl tape and glass wall.

Although they worked for many years, I opted to...

Although they worked for many years, I opted to change all the pop rivet/acorn nut combos for Stainless Steel screws, acorn nuts, and a flange washer as pictured. A bit of locktite helps.

If the freezer is working then the frig is...

If the freezer is working then the frig is working. As mentioned by others these absorption units will only lower the temperature about 40 deg below ambient.
